Is QuickBooks Desktop for Construction Contractors Being Discontinued?

There have been rumors about QuickBooks Desktop being retired for many years, yet QuickBooks Online still isn't the same capability level as Intuit's older software for contractors. Some recent announcements from them give us more of a direction, and these announcements weren't given to the general public. We're sharing what you need to know this week.
Topics we cover in this episode include:

  • Recent announcements from Intuit on QuickBooks Online
  • QuickBooks Desktop became a subscription model in 2022
  • QuickBooks stopped selling the payroll subscription to the general public
  • Other accounting software options
  • Key things to look for in bookkeeping software
